#087464 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#087464 is composed of 3.1% red, 45.5%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.8%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 171.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 24.3%. #087464 color hex could be obtained by blending #10e8c8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#087464

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000605 is the darkest color, while #f3f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#087464

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c403f is the less saturated color, while #037967 is the most saturated one.
